Students Access the Outdoors through NHEE’d To Get Outside Grants

The New Hampshire Environmental Educators awarded over $30,000 in NHEE’d to Get Outside grants to 23 schools and organizations for 2024. Schools and nonprofits receive this funding to help their students access the outdoors whether it is for admission and transportation for field trips to nature spaces, snowshoes for winter exploration or science tools for outdoor learning.

New Hampshire Environmental Educators (NHEE) is a 501(c)(3) non-profit organization with the mission to inspire connection to our natural world by supporting high-quality environmental education and advancing environmental literacy. NHEE is our only state organization for environmental educators and has been in operation since 1979.
